  6. Cannot recognize/package .ai files from .indd files linked to another .indd file

    See this forum post:
    https://community.adobe.com/t5/indesign/is-it-possible-to-package-an-indesign-document-that-has-linking-indesign-documents/m-p/11629673?page=1#M405575

    When linking to another .indd file, and then creating a package, the package will include .psd, .jpg and .png files from the linked .indd file. However, it appears that .ai files are not recognized in the main file's link panel and are not packaged. The other non-.ai links to the sub-file's assets are included in the main file's links panel as well.

  9. Danish translation in 'EPUB Export Options' is wrong

    In the EPUB Export Options window - Metadata - two fields are translated into Danish. But this is not done correctly.
    Re: field 3 "Created by" and 7 "Rights".

    This Text: > should be translated into this

      Oprettet af: > Forfatter:
    
      Højre: > Copyright:
    

    (because 'Forfatter' means 'Author' and this metadata information is requied in EPUBs.. and 'Højre' means the opposite of left ... so this is NOT the case here ;)

  20. Incorrect re-linking of image files with rotation metadata

    This bug occurs in all versions of InDesign.

    InDesign reflects the EXIF orientation in the transform panel when an image file is placed. However, under the following conditions, the result of relinking will be incorrect.

    • The image file is rotated 90 degrees with EXIF orientation.
    • In the transform panel, the vertical and horizontal percentage values are different.

    Image files taken with an iPhone often retain the EXIF orientation rotation. If such a file is placed in indd by the client and the vertical and horizontal percentage values are different, there will be a problem that will cause drastic changes in…
